Assessing Attorney Experience



When picking a criminal defense attorney, evaluating their experience is important. You'll intend to dive deep right into their past cases to understand not just the quantity of situations they have actually managed, yet the quality of end results attained.

It's not just about for how long they've been exercising, but just how well they have actually taken care of cases similar to yours. Search for specifics: Have they took care of fees like yours prior to? The amount of of those cases went to trial, and what were the outcomes?

It's crucial you know they've got a solid performance history with successful results in circumstances comparable to what you're encountering. Experience in a court is especially invaluable if your case goes to test. You don't simply want someone that knows the regulation; you need someone who maneuvers properly within the courtroom dynamics.

Additionally, check where they've acquired their experience. Somebody that's familiar with the local courts and judges can be useful. They'll understand regional treatments and subtleties which can play an essential function in the protection approach.

Picking somebody seasoned can make all the difference. Ensure their experience aligns closely with your demands, providing you the best shot at a beneficial result.

Understanding Protection Strategies



Recognizing the different defense strategies your attorney might utilize is vital to successfully browsing your instance. Each approach rests on the specifics of the fees you're facing and the evidence versus you. Allow's look into what you require to understand.

First of all, if there's a lack of evidence, your legal representative may argue that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. Bear in mind, it's not your work to show virtue; it's the district attorney's job to prove shame beyond an affordable uncertainty. If they can't, you should be acquitted.


An additional typical technique is self-defense, especially in cases involving costs like assault or homicide. If you were securing on your own, your attorney might use this approach to warrant your actions legitimately. This needs showing that your understanding of hazard was reasonable and that your feedback was proportional to that danger.
